Women's World Cup 2010

The Women's World Cup will be held in Rosario, Argentina from 29 August - 11 September 2010.


The International Hockey Federation (FIH) has announced the pools for the BDO FIH World Cup women, to be played in Rosario, Argentina from 29 August-11 September 2010.

After Australia qualified as the 12th and final team, the twelve participants were allocated into two pools of six teams each based upon the latest ABN AMRO World Rankings.
England’s women will play in Pool B of the tournament where they will meet the hosts and winners of the 2009 Champions Trophy Argentina, Beijing Olympic silver medalists China, European rivals Spain, Korea and South Africa.
England Women Team TalkOlympic Champion and defending World Cup holders  the Netherlands are the top seeded side in Pool A. The Dutch will meet Germany, Australia, Japan, New Zealand and India in the pool matches.
The teams ranked first and second of each pool after the single round robin preliminary phase will proceed to the semi finals. The FIH will release the match schedule in the coming weeks. Please click here to be redirected to the FIH website.
